Output 81bf60eedf8ef2a97bce602b0e5086e2f240e04145a89f73ee3d5b96cc97e811:9

value
7105736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e7fe41e10fc407b4b10cc14cd47271fcb9370b OP_EQUAL
address
MBdTBGnhwUdHfXjWdVCi9iAWqWf2fQnvCS
transaction
81bf60eedf8ef2a97bce602b0e5086e2f240e04145a89f73ee3d5b96cc97e811
spent
true